About This Role

As a Marketing Proposal Manager for Power Transformers, you will lead the development of competitive bids that secure major contracts for utility and industrial clients. This role is critical in translating technical specifications into compelling value propositions, ensuring compliance, and driving revenue growth. Your work directly supports Hitachi Energy's mission by enabling the deployment of essential grid infrastructure.

💡 A Day in the Life

Your day starts with reviewing incoming bid requests and prioritizing tasks based on deadlines. You'll coordinate with engineering to clarify technical specifications, work with sales to refine pricing strategies, and draft executive summaries that highlight Hitachi Energy's competitive advantages. Afternoons are spent reviewing proposal drafts for compliance, updating bid trackers, and preparing for kickoff meetings with cross-functional teams.

🎯 Who HITACHI ENERGY Is Looking For

  • Experienced in proposal management within the power transformer or heavy electrical equipment industry, with a proven track record of winning large-scale bids.
  • Able to interpret complex engineering requirements and translate them into clear, persuasive proposal content that resonates with both technical and business stakeholders.
  • Strong project management skills to coordinate cross-functional teams (engineering, sales, legal) under tight deadlines while maintaining accuracy and compliance.
  • Familiar with regulatory standards (e.g., IEEE, IEC) and procurement processes for utilities and large EPC contractors.

🔍 Research Before Applying

To stand out, make sure you've researched:

  • Review Hitachi Energy's recent press releases and case studies on power transformer installations, especially large-scale utility projects.
  • Understand the company's sustainability report and how its products contribute to carbon reduction targets.
  • Familiarize yourself with the competitive landscape for power transformers, including key players like Siemens Energy and GE Vernova.
  • Explore Hitachi Energy's digital solutions for transformers (e.g., TXpert) to discuss how proposals can highlight digital value.

💬 Prepare for These Interview Topics

Based on this role, you may be asked about:

1 Walk me through a time you managed a proposal for a large power transformer project. What was your strategy and outcome?
2 How do you ensure accuracy and compliance when coordinating inputs from engineering, legal, and sales teams?
3 Describe a situation where you had to persuade a reluctant stakeholder to meet a proposal deadline.
4 How do you stay updated on industry standards (e.g., IEEE/ANSI) and incorporate them into proposals?
5 What is your approach to balancing customer requirements with Hitachi Energy's internal profitability goals?
